About this role

Join Amazon's team as a Warehouse Shopper, where you'll select, pack, and prepare customer orders for delivery in a fast-paced environment.

About the Company

Amazon is a global leader in e-commerce and technology, known for its vast selection and customer-centric approach.

Key Highlights

  • Competitive pay ranging from $17 to $23 per hour
  • Opportunity to work in a fast-paced fulfillment environment
  • Hands-on role with use of handheld scanners
  • Full-time positions available

Expert Review

Working at Amazon as a Warehouse Shopper can be a solid entry point into the logistics field. Employees are expected to handle tasks efficiently, which can be rewarding for those who thrive in fast-paced settings.

The starting pay of $17 to $23 per hour is competitive, especially for entry-level roles. However, the physically demanding nature of the job means that candidates should consider their comfort with manual labor and long shifts.

Our team found that while the benefits of working for a large company like Amazon include potential advancement opportunities, the reality of the workload can be challenging. Many employees report feeling fatigued by the end of their shifts, highlighting the importance of stamina and resilience.
